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/86.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使用jquery将html表格导出到excel?_Jquery_Asp.net_Html - Fatal编程技术网

如何使用jquery将html表格导出到excel?

如何使用jquery将html表格导出到excel?,jquery,asp.net,html,Jquery,Asp.net,Html,我正在制作一个页面,它显示超过25K的记录,没有分页。 当我使用以下jquery代码将其导出到excel时 它给了我页面崩溃的错误 window.open('data:application/vnd.ms excel,'+encodeURIComponent('+$('.grid-view')).html()+' 它可以处理少量的记录,但当记录超过1500时,它会开始破坏浏览器页面 请帮我解决这个问题 提前感谢也许可以作为附件下载,而不是显示在浏览器中。代码已经在下载excel文件。但它在单击导

我正在制作一个页面,它显示超过25K的记录,没有分页。 当我使用以下jquery代码将其导出到excel时

它给了我页面崩溃的错误

window.open('data:application/vnd.ms excel,'+encodeURIComponent('+$('.grid-view')).html()+' 它可以处理少量的记录,但当记录超过1500时,它会开始破坏浏览器页面

请帮我解决这个问题


提前感谢

也许可以作为附件下载,而不是显示在浏览器中。

代码已经在下载excel文件。但它在单击导出按钮和下载excel之间崩溃了。不要在一个页面上显示25000条记录,这是一场噩梦——还要想想那些没有你那么强大的机器的用户——他们的browser会崩溃的。@Chirag你找到解决问题的方法了吗,bcz我也面临同样的问题。不,我找不到解决问题的方法。